c#

C # (sprich "Cis") ist eine objektorientierte Programmiersprache auf hohem Niveau, die für die Erstellung einer Vielzahl von Anwendungen entwickelt wurde, die auf dem .NET Framework (oder .NET Core) ausgeführt werden. C # ist einfach, leistungsfähig, typsicher und objektorientiert.
1
Antwort

PInvoic char * in C DLL behandelt als String in C #. Problem mit Nullzeichen

Die Funktion in C DLL sieht folgendermaßen aus: %Vor% Ich muss dies von C # app aufrufen. Ich mache das auf folgende Weise: %Vor% Die Eingabe-Zeichenfolge wird perfekt an die DLL übertragen (ich habe einen sichtbaren Beweis dafür). Die A...
07.03.2013, 14:29
4
Antworten

Regex mit nicht einfangender Gruppe in C #

Ich verwende die folgende Regex %Vor% bei der folgenden Art von Daten: %Vor% Die Idee besteht darin, zwei Gruppen zu extrahieren, von denen jede eine Zeile enthält (beginnend mit der Joint Number, 1, 2, usw.). Der C # -Code ist wie folgt...
02.03.2013, 03:12
5
Antworten

Was ist der Unterschied zwischen Kapazität und maxCapacity im StringBuilder-Konstruktor?

Es gibt einen -Konstruktor in der Klasse StringBuilder (int32, int32). Sie sehen, dass zwei Parameter vorhanden sind: Kapazität und maxCapacity . Ich habe versucht, den Unterschied zwischen Kapazität und maxCapacity in StringBuilder-Ko...
01.03.2014, 06:20
3
Antworten

Filterung ist nicht erlaubt

Ich habe eine Aktionsmethode implementiert, um HTML zu minimieren. Es gibt eine Ausnahme: "Filterung ist nicht erlaubt". Ich habe das Internet durchsucht, konnte aber keine geeignete Lösung finden. Bitte führen Sie mich mit diesem, wie ich diese...
17.05.2014, 06:06
1
Antwort

Programmgesteuert Konvertieren von Excel 2003-Dateien in 2007+

Ich suche nach einer Möglichkeit, im Wesentlichen einen Ordner mit Excel-Dateien, die die alte Dateierweiterung .xls 2003 sind, zu erstellen und sie in .xlsm umzuwandeln. Mir ist klar, dass du selbst in das Excel-Blatt einsteigen und es manuell...
19.09.2013, 20:43
7
Antworten

Äquivalent von C ++ 's reininterpret_cast in C #

Ich frage mich, was C ++% reinterpret_cast in C # bedeutet !? Hier ist mein Beispiel: %Vor% Ich habe keine Einwände, warum f null sein wird, da es so sein sollte. Aber wenn es C ++ wäre, hätte ich Foo f = reinterpret_cast<Foo>...
21.10.2013, 14:51
3
Antworten

foreach vs für: Bitte erklären Sie die Assembly Code-Differenz

Ich habe kürzlich die Leistung der for-Schleife gegen die foreach-Schleife in C # getestet, und ich habe festgestellt, dass die foreach-Schleife tatsächlich schneller auskommt, wenn man ein Array von Ints zu einem long summiert. Hier ist das vo...
10.01.2013, 16:24
1
Antwort

Warum ist IsGenericParameter für einen generischen Parameter falsch?

Ich habe eine Methode wie folgt definiert: %Vor% Wenn ich die MethodInfo für diese Methode ansehe, finde ich %Vor% ist false . Ich habe erwartet, dass es true ist, weil der zweite Parameter den Typ T hat. (Auf der anderen Seit...
13.09.2013, 13:29
2
Antworten

Refreshing Label Inhalt jede Sekunde WPF

Ich versuche, einen Etiketteninhalt jede Sekunde zu aktualisieren. Also definiere ich zwei Methoden wie folgt. Ich benutze startStatusBarTimer() in meinem Konstruktor von Window . Codes: %Vor% Aber ich bekomme diesen Fehler: Der...
15.09.2013, 19:23
6
Antworten

Ist es möglich, einen "privaten" oder "öffentlichen" Block in C # zu erstellen, wie in C ++? [Duplikat]

In C ++ ist es möglich, einen "Block" von Mitgliedern durch Privatsphäre zu erstellen: %Vor% Ich habe versucht, in C # Beispiele dafür zu finden, konnte aber keine finden. Ich habe versucht, einen solchen Block in Visual Studio zu schreibe...
18.03.2013, 15:56